概述:
tpwallet 的发现页(Discover)不仅是用户接触 dApp、DeFi 与 NFT 的入口,也是连接钱包核心能力与生态服务的枢纽。一个优秀的发现页应在信息呈现、交互效率与安全保障之间找到平衡,推动从“发现”到“使用”的转化。
一键支付功能:
一键支付(One-Click Pay)是提升转化率的关键。实现上需结合以下技术和交互设计:预授权与细粒度权限(token、金额上限、时间窗)、Gas 抽象与代付(meta-transaction、relayer)、交易模版与快速确认(确认页最小化但保留重要信息),以及失败回退机制。对高信任场景可引入多重签名或生物验证,降低误操作风险。前端要保证按钮可见性与明确的状态反馈(处理中/成功/失败)。
账户余额与实时资产监控:
发现页应展示账户净值、各资产明细与流动性位置(池、借贷、质押)。实现方式包括链上数据聚合器、价格预言机与多链索引服务。实时性可采用 WebSocket / 推送订阅、轻量化事件监听或增量索引(event-driven indexer)。为了兼顾性能与成本,常用策略为:周期性快照 + 增量事件流;前端缓存与差分更新;对高价值资产或用户自选标的提供秒级推送通知。
前瞻性技术趋势:
未来发现页将受多项技术驱动:Layer-2 与 Rollup 的普及使交易成本下降、体验更接近 Web2;Account Abstraction(智能账户)将简化付款流程并支持社会恢复与多因子;MPC 与硬件钱包整合提高私钥安全且更好支持跨设备流转;零知识(ZK)技术可用于隐私保护与压缩链上证明以提升查询效率;AI 可在内容推荐、风险预警与自动化策略(例如自动再平衡)中发挥作用。
高效能技术变革:

为支撑海量并发访问与复杂查询,发现页后端需采用高效索引(如基于事件的二级索引)、流式处理(Kafka/Redis Stream)、WASM 微服务与边缘缓存(CDN + edge computing)。对链上数据的复杂计算建议离线批处理 + 近实时增量,热点数据在内存数据库(Redis、Rockset 等)中服务。同时,前端采用渐进式加载、差分渲染和本地合并计算以降低延迟。

浏览器插件钱包(Extension Wallet)的定位与挑战:
插件钱包是用户体验的最后一公里,需在权限模型、隔离执行、签名可见性与易用性之间取舍。安全防护包括权限请求最小化、沙箱化页面通信、请求白名单、显式签名预览与签名历史可追溯。扩展的发现页可与插件紧密协作:支持 dApp 的安全预览、交易模拟(gas 与失败可能性提示)、以及基于用户持仓的个性化推荐。同时应支持与移动端或硬件钱包的无缝联动(WalletConnect、BLE、二维码)。
实践建议(产品+工程):
- 产品:把发现页做成可组合的模块(榜单、活动、教程、资产洞察、任务与奖励),并允许用户自定义关注列表。优先支持“一键支付”场景的可逆操作与明确风险提示。引入信任评级与社区内容减轻信息茧房。
- 工程:后端采用事件驱动索引,提供低延时订阅 API;前端优先本地聚合与差分渲染;引入交易模拟与沙箱执行以减少用户失败率;采用 AB 测试评估一键支付转化与安全警示的效果。
结语:
tpwallet 的发现页既是展示生态的窗口,也是钱包能力的展示台。通过把一键支付、账户余额与实时资产监控打通,结合前瞻技术(Account Abstraction、MPC、ZK、L2)与高效能架构,发现页可以从信息入口进化为用户资产管理与安全决策的智能中枢。
评论
Tiger88
关于一键支付的权限控制写得很细,尤其是meta-transaction那部分很实用。
小蓝
喜欢把发现页看成资产管理中枢的观点,实时推送和差分更新是关键。
CryptoNina
建议再补充一下对多签和社恢复的具体实现场景,会更完整。
张三
浏览器插件钱包的隔离与签名可见性讲得到位,希望能看到更多 UX 示例。
Luna
前瞻性技术趋势部分很有洞察,Account Abstraction 和 ZK 的结合值得期待。